Turkey 7-Day Itinerary

  1. Friday December 22: Istanbul
    30 minutes (18.5 km) from Istanbul Airport

    Start your day with a visit to the iconic Hagia Sophia, then explore the stunning Blue Mosque and Topkapi Palace. In the afternoon, wander through the bustling Grand Bazaar and indulge in some traditional Turkish cuisine. In the evening, take a relaxing cruise along the Bosphorus Strait.

    • Hagia Sophia: Free entry, 2-3 hours
    • Blue Mosque: Free entry, 1 hour
    • Topkapi Palace: $15, 2-3 hours
    • Grand Bazaar: Free entry, 2-3 hours
    • Bosphorus Cruise: $20, 2 hours
